What is Conservative Dental Care?

Conservative dental care is a philosophy and practice in dentistry that aims to preserve as much of the natural tooth structure as possible. This approach minimizes invasive procedures and prioritizes preventive care, focusing on maintaining oral health through education and lifestyle adjustments. The goal is to treat dental issues with the least amount of intervention necessary, promoting the longevity and health of the teeth.

Examples of Conservative Dental Care

  1. Preventive Care: This includes regular dental check-ups, cleanings, and patient education about proper oral hygiene practices, such as brushing and flossing.
  2. Fluoride Treatments: Application of fluoride to strengthen tooth enamel and prevent decay.
  3. Dental Sealants: A protective coating applied to the chewing surfaces of the back teeth to prevent cavities.
  4. Minimal Intervention Dentistry: A philosophy that focuses on early detection and treatment of dental issues to prevent progression, using techniques like air abrasion or laser treatments.
  5. Restorative Procedures: When necessary, procedures like fillings are performed using materials that match the natural tooth color, often preserving more of the tooth than traditional methods.

Benefits of Conservative Dental Care

  • Preservation of Tooth Structure: By avoiding unnecessary procedures, patients retain more of their natural tooth, which is stronger and more durable than artificial replacements.
  • Reduced Risk of Complications: Less invasive procedures typically carry lower risks of complications such as infections or discomfort.
  • Cost-Effective: Preventive and conservative treatments can often reduce the need for more costly and extensive dental work in the future.
  • Enhanced Comfort: Patients experience less discomfort and anxiety with minimally invasive procedures compared to more extensive dental work.
  • Focus on Long-Term Oral Health: By emphasizing prevention and education, patients are empowered to maintain their oral health over the long term, resulting in fewer dental issues.
